Most organizations cannot accurately count how many APIs run in production. Development teams create new endpoints daily, third-party integrations multiply, and legacy systems persist long after documentation disappears. Shadow APIs, zombie endpoints, and undocumented services expand the attack surface faster than security teams can track.
Browser extensions and automated scanning tools solve the visibility problem. Running continuously in the background, API discovery extensions monitor network traffic, identify undocumented endpoints, and build complete inventories of your API landscape without manual effort.
Why Manual API Discovery Fails
Manual API tracking cannot keep pace with modern development velocity. Teams push code multiple times per day, and every release can introduce new API endpoints. Without automation, your API inventory becomes outdated within hours.
According to the Gartner 2024 Market Guide for API Protection, the average API breach leaks at least 10 times more data than typical security breaches. Shadow APIs and dormant endpoints cause most incidents because they operate outside security policies.
Hidden APIs fall into three categories that create significant risk:
- Shadow APIs: Undocumented endpoints created without IT approval
- Zombie APIs: Deprecated APIs that remain accessible after teams stop maintaining them
- Orphaned APIs: Endpoints with no clear owner in the organization
Manual tracking misses all three. Automated discovery catches them continuously.
How Browser Extensions Automate API Discovery
Browser extensions capture and analyze HTTP traffic as developers and testers interact with applications. Running locally, the extension monitors every request and response, building an internal representation of your API contracts in real time.
Several options exist for browser-based API discovery:
- Detector APIs Extension: An open-source tool that detects APIs and generates cURL commands for any website on load. No data collection, no ads.
- Qyrus API Discovery: Integrates into Chrome developer tools for seamless API testing and interaction analysis.
- Hidden APIs: Reveals hidden APIs and enables inspection, scraping, and automation of tasks.
Traffic-based discovery works in four steps:
- The extension intercepts HTTP requests and responses during normal browsing
- Pattern recognition identifies API endpoints, methods, and data types
- The tool maps relationships between endpoints
- OpenAPI specifications are generated automatically from collected data
When a developer adds a quick endpoint for testing and forgets to document it, traffic-based discovery still captures the activity.
Enterprise API Discovery Beyond Browser Extensions
Browser extensions work well for individual discovery, but enterprise API security requires broader automation. Combining extensions with platform-level scanning creates comprehensive coverage across complex environments.
Deploy Network-Level Monitoring
Start with tools that scan all environments, including cloud, on-premises, containers, and edge deployments. Network-level monitoring catches API traffic that browser extensions miss, particularly server-to-server communication and internal APIs.
APIsec's automated discovery maps every API endpoint across your infrastructure. The platform analyzes REST, GraphQL, and SOAP APIs to build a complete inventory without manual configuration.
Integrate Discovery into CI/CD Pipelines
Automate API scanning within your development workflow. When discovery runs on every build, new endpoints get logged before deployment. Security teams gain visibility into API changes as they happen, not weeks later during manual audits.
Pipeline integration catches shadow APIs early. When developers create undocumented endpoints, automated scanning flags them during the build process rather than after production deployment.
Classify and Tag APIs by Risk
Not all APIs carry equal risk. Public APIs need different security controls than internal endpoints. Tag discovered APIs by exposure level, data sensitivity, and ownership.
Metadata enrichment improves governance. When security teams can filter APIs by classification, they prioritize testing on high-risk endpoints. Look for platforms that automatically categorize discovered APIs and integrate findings with existing security tools.
Maintain Continuous Monitoring
API discovery works best as an ongoing process, not a one-time project. Your inventory changes constantly as development continues. Schedule regular reconciliation between discovery results and your documented API registry.
Continuous monitoring also detects API drift. When an endpoint's behavior changes from its documented specification, automated tools catch the discrepancy. Security teams can investigate whether the change was intentional or indicates a problem.
Choosing the Right API Discovery Tools
The best discovery approach combines multiple methods. Browser extensions capture developer activity, network scanning finds server-to-server APIs, and code analysis identifies endpoints before deployment.
Essential capabilities to evaluate:
- Consistent scanning of both active and inactive APIs
- CI/CD integration for DevSecOps workflows
- Real-time analytics and reporting for actionable insights
- OpenAPI specification generation from observed traffic
- Classification and tagging for governance
For organizations that need comprehensive security testing alongside discovery, APIsec provides AI-powered scanning that identifies vulnerabilities immediately after detecting endpoints.
From Discovery to Security Testing
Locating your APIs is only the first step. Every discovered endpoint needs security testing to identify vulnerabilities before attackers do.
The Salt Security Q1 2025 State of API Security Report found that 99% of organizations encountered API security issues within the past 12 months. Most incidents exploited unknown or unprotected endpoints, exactly the APIs that discovery tools are designed to uncover.
Automated discovery feeds directly into security testing workflows. When APIsec discovers a new endpoint, the platform immediately runs AI-powered attack simulations against it, testing for OWASP API Top 10 vulnerabilities, business logic flaws, and access control issues without manual configuration.
Start Securing Your API Inventory
APIsec combines automated API discovery with continuous security testing. The platform maps every endpoint across your infrastructure and immediately tests for vulnerabilities, all integrated into your existing CI/CD pipeline.
Visit APIsec and Start Your Free Trial to see how APIsec identifies hidden APIs and security gaps in your environment.
FAQs
What is the difference between API discovery and API scanning?
API discovery identifies what APIs exist in your environment. API scanning tests those APIs for security vulnerabilities. Most security programs need both.
How do browser extensions find shadow APIs?
Browser extensions monitor HTTP traffic during normal application use. When a request hits an undocumented endpoint, the extension captures and adds it to your discovered API inventory.
Can automated discovery replace API documentation?
Automated discovery supplements documentation but cannot replace it. Discovery shows what endpoints exist and how they behave. Documentation explains why they exist and how developers should use them.
How often should API discovery run?
Continuous discovery provides the best coverage. Run discovery scans with every deployment to catch new endpoints immediately. At a minimum, schedule weekly full scans.
What happens after discovery finds a shadow API?
Security teams should evaluate every shadow API for risk. Determine whether the endpoint serves a legitimate business purpose, add proper documentation if it does, or deprecate it if unnecessary.

.webp)

